Board clarifies Citizens Field move was exploratory; no contracts or funding approved
Summary
Board members and community speakers discussed a proposed stadium project known as Citizens Field. Board members said the vote gave the superintendent authority only to explore partnership options with the city; no funding, contracts or land purchases were approved.
Discussion about a possible district stadium — referred to as Citizens Field by speakers — drew strong public reaction at the meeting. Several speakers urged the board to prioritize instructional needs and facility repairs over large capital projects.
Board members and the superintendent emphasized the district had not committed funds or signed agreements. Chair Rockwell said the board had voted only to authorize the superintendent to explore possibilities and potential partnerships with the City of Gainesville; she stressed that no contracts, capital allocations or land purchases had been approved.
